Understanding Millwork Drafting
Millwork makes reference to custom woodwork created in a mill or workshop—think more specifically about doors, draws, cabinets, mouldings, furniture arrangements, or decorative fittings. Millwork drafting is technical drawings that are with detail for these elements; in the millwork drafting is detailed dimensions, materials, finishes, and assembly of how everything goes together.
These drawings provide the means of communication between architects, engineers, contractors, and manufacturers. Simply, without millwork drafting, it would be virtually impossible to ensure that each manufactured component fits accurately within a project’s parameters or within the safety and design standards.

Millwork Shop Drawings
At the core of millwork drafting is the shop drawing. Shop drawings are detailed documents that describe measurements, methods of construction, materials, and instructions for assembly. In essence, shop drawings convert a design concept to documents that can be used to fabricate pieces while still ensuring it meets the structural and design intent.
They typically include:
- Accurate dimensions and tolerances
- Material specifications
- Joinery and construction methods
- Assembly and installation instructions
- Final finishing details
By linking design and production, shop drawings reduce ambiguity and provide a reliable guide for manufacturers.
